Lábjegyzetek a magyar PuppyLinux jövőjéhez
4 napos elmerülésem oka a Linux alaverzumban egy Dual-Core-os HP laptop 2GB Rammal és egy olyan felhasználói csoport, akiknél éles helyzetben bizonyított a CubLinux. (A végeredményt a Vadászatomban rőgzítettem.) Kutatásom közben jutottam vissza a Browserlinux-hoz (és a megújult Slaxhoz) mivel a Cublinuxot már nem fejlesztik (újjáélesztése phoenixlinux néven vergődik. Biztos túl vizes lett a hamuja), gondoltam a browserlinuxot sem gondozzák (a honlapja alapján) de szánnok rá némi időt és nosztalgiából megnézem mi a helyzet. További két napot töltöttem ott.
Eme szómenés-halmaz a puppy mai helyzetét hivatott tisztába tenni főleg számomra (immáron szigorúan csak buta civil felhasználó). Ha feljut a fórumba és ismét viharokat váltok ki, hát majd kitörlik (miután jól leoltottak miatta) de talán a sok alkotó elmének egy újabb lökést adhat annélkül, hogy észrevennék.
Már nem vagyok képben a Puppy-val mint annak idején, ezért bocsánat ha elavult dolgokat/hülyeségeket írok. A környezetemben olyan Internet használók élnek akik csak az Androidot és a Windows-t ismerik (és ez a fiatalok igen nagy százaléka) valamint hozzá vannak szokva/elvárják a tiszta felhasználói élményt. Ez maximum az adott program/app beépített beállításainak mélységéig értendő. Ezért az általam írtak is lehetőleg ilyen szintűek lesznek.
Először 2 pupletben gondolkodtam, a manapság már kihaló 32 és az aktuális 64 bit-es verziókban. De úgy tűnik, hogy Csipesz munkássága visszanyúlik a még régebbi gépekhez is így 3 pupletet vázolok fel.
Általam ChromePuppy-nak hivott pupletről zagyválok. Röviden Cpup amit valamiért inkább (ejtsd:) Szípup-nak hívok.
Méretek: szerintem a CD-k kapacitása legyen a maximum, mert így még az 1 GB-os pendrive-okon is marad hely visszamenteni a beállításokat. A további bővíthetőségük pupletenként változó. Telepítés után a következő programokat tartalmazza (lényegében a Slax tudását tudja csak a gépigényeknek megfelelően) Böngésző, fájl-kezelő, mindenes (videó és hang) média lejátszó (kisebbeken csak mp3 szintű) beállítás panel (Control Center), terminál, számológép, notepad-szintű editor, csomagoló(és grafikus csomagkezelő)program...stb. (
https://distrowatch.com/images/cgfjoewdlbc/slax.png)
Ezen funkciókat ellátó programok szintén pupletenként változóak.
Cpup64
Ezzel viszonylag könnyű dolgom van attól eltekintve, hogy az alap puplet miatt (XenialPup64 XFCE) valószínüleg máris kinőtte a CD méretet. De lepucolva biztos kisebb lesz. Programok hozzáadása a jelenleg használható Ubuntus/puppy-s tároló. Böngésző a Chromium, van saját fájl-kezelője, médialejátszója de csomagból felmegy a VLC és a Double Commander. Valamint könnyen skinezhető, erről bővebben a Külalak bekezdésben.
Cpup32
Nos, ez egy vitatott verzió mert olyan gép korosztályra gondoltam ahol már megjelennek a 64 bit-es gépek is (elején említett laptop is) Mivel 32 bit-es verzió és ezt már a linux közösség (legalábbis az Ubuntu és az Internet biztos) dobta, ezért talán szükség lenne az sfs csatoló funkcióra ahonnan a készítők által itélt legjobb 32 bites program verziók lehetnének csatolhatók (böngésző, médialejátszó, Office csomag, egyéb alkalmazások...szóval amik a legjobbak még 32 biten. Ezek egyszer elkészülnek, neten elérhetők és már nem kell a naprakészségükkel foglalkozni). Böngészőnek a SeaMonkey internet-csomag frissíthető de automatikusan nem frissülő (első indításnál megkérdezi de nem lesz kötelező) változatát javaslom. Ha többet is bír a gép, telepít nagyobbat. Ha nem, ebben is elég sok minden megtalálható a netes kapcsolat tartáshoz (levelező, hírolvasó, név/címjegyzék...stb.).
Alapjának szintén valamelyik aktív disztró csomagjait kezelő verziót kellene választani (vagy csak vmi deb csomagkezelőt mert a legtöbb program oldalának csomagkinálatában szerepel a *.deb-es verzió, + kellene egy függőség-kezelő.), ami megkönnyítené az sfs tesztelés után az esetleges állandó telepítést. (Régebben volt egy puplet ami csak sfs-ben csatolt mindent de néha le is dobta ezért pld. lejátszás közben elszáll a VLC sfs, vagy a böngésző, ami bosszantó/negatív reklám tud lenni. De ha kipróbálás után fixen tudja telepíteni...)
Mivel minimalista verziónak vannak szánva, nem ártana mindkét verzióban a nem napi felhasználói programokat elkülöníteni/eldugni. Arról nem is beszélve, hogy nem kell 2-3 beállítgatási módot szem előtt hagyni, mert csak megzavarja és elriasztja a felhasználót. Ezt szintén a Slax-on tudom szemlélteni. Csak azokból tud választani amik értelemszerű használat mellett nem horpasztja be a rendszert.
Cpup32retro
Egyszerűbb megoldása a feladatnak: Csipesz által felújított BrowserLinux további csiszolása.
De választható más alap puplet is. Nem tudom, hogy van-e még régebbi, egyszerű napi használatra tervezett hardware ami nem bírná el a sima Cpup32-t (Van-e egyáltalán értelme ilyen célra használni azt a gépet).
Ez a verzió már inkább hozzáértőknek készül(ne). Itt is élhetne az sfs csatoló, itt nem kellene eldugni az összes barkácsoló-varázslót, puppy ISO készítés...stb. Guru beállítja, behangolja, csinál egy biztonsági mentést az alapbeállításokról amire talán nem lesz szükség a felhasználó miatt.
Külalak: Érdemes lenne Skami által felfedezett Transformation Pack-ot begyűjteni és hadrafogni. Nem tudom, hogy már telepítve ajánljuk a pupletekben vagy választható verzióként. Telepítve sokat javít az elfogadottságukon. Szerintem.
Javasolt felszerelés:
Cpup64: Telepítve Win 10 (xFCE-n jó); választható: bármelyiket. A GUI bármelyiket elbírja.
Cpup32: Telepítve a Windows 7-t javasolnám de ha az ajánlott hardver még az XP-s korszakból származik, akkor legyen az; választható:(?) elbírja a GUI a felhasználói beavatkozást? Vagy elég volt felhegeszteni rá?
Cpup32retro: Telepíteni (ha lehetséges) WinXP. Ha nem, - ami nem kizárt,- akkor valami világos (paszteles) hangulatú külső, lásd megint Slax. ( elsőre a klasszikus Windows külső is logikus választás lenne de ez már túl rondának hatna, valamint nem biztos, hogy feltelepül, így akkor már a Slax design/feeling (

) a rendelkezésre álló felületből könnyebben kihozható)
Honosítás: Természetesen minél mélyebben, annál jobb. De mint írtam: "...az adott program/app beépített beállításainak mélységéig értendő."
Ez a Cpup64-ben a xFCE fejleztői úgyis intézik, a nagyobb programokhoz vagy van csomag, vagy beépítve tartalmazza vagy esélytelen.
Cpup32: Itt már csak a nagyobb programoknál úszható meg a dolog illetve a választott alap puplet eddigi honosításának mértékén és a beválasztott programok/modulok lefordítottságán.
Cpup32retro: A Vadnyugat/Háborús Zóna ebből a szempontból. Mivel hozzáértőknek készül elkerülhetetlen az angol nyelvű felület. Aki érez rá esélyt a kevés modul és program miatt, annak kihívás.
[+] Biztonsági Puppy már van, a magyar Puli 7.0. (Nagy tiszteletem az Alkotóknak) De azt nem adhatom 1.0-ás felhasználóknak, az megzavarná őket, ők meg összezavarnák szegény Pulit.
[-] Rendszer helyreállító és mentő puplethez példaként a Hiren's Boot CD/pendrive programválasztékához hasonló összeállítás puppy-n elérhető verziókkal (vagy egy saját puppy-t mentő puplet!) lenne elsőre felmerülő ötlet de a nagyobb pupletek amúgy is tartalmazzák az alapvető, könnyen használható programokat. (particionáló, biztonsági mentés...stb.) Talán maga a Hiren's is feleslegessé teszi ennek létjogosultságát az egyszerű felhasználók szemében.
Első olvasatra biztos mindenki rávágja, hogy magasra tettem a lécet és hogy kibicként lehetetlen kívánságaim vannak (meg könnyen írogatok...stb.). De éppen azért bontottam szét, mert részekre bontva vannak eredmények, alapok (Skami Win10-es xFce-s felülete, minimalista felépítésű puppy a Browserlinux).
Az általam leírtak kézzelfogható célokat adnak a közösségnek, olyan célokat amellyel közelebb vihetik a puppy-t az egyszerű napi felhasználókhoz. Ma. Manapság. Szerintem.
Köszönöm a figyelmet és az erőfeszítést amit írományom megfejtésére fordítottak.
Források:
Transformation Pack: https://skamilinux.hu/nem-tetszik-akkor ... agy-macos/ & https://b00merang.weebly.com/themes.html
CubLinux -> https://distrowatch.com/table.php?distribution=cub v. https://phoenixlinux.weebly.com/
Slax -> https://www.slax.org/
Browserlinux -> https://skamilinux.hu/browser431-vlc-hu-kros54-csipesz/ & viewtopic.php?f=7&t=321&p=7138#p7138
PuLi 7.0 -> https://skamilinux.hu/puli-7-0/
Hiren's Boot CD/pendrive ->https://www.hiren.info/pages/bootcd-on-usb-disk v. https://www.hirensbootcd.org/usb-booting/